Lang <br />Re: Final Phase II/fIi Bond Release Inspe ction, Meeker Area Mines, C-81-032 Division Direcmr <br />Dear Mr. Jensen: <br />The purpose of [his letter is to advise you of a final Phase 11/11[ Bond Release inspection (Inspection) of <br />the Meeker Area Mines (Northern # I and Rienau #2) scheduled for 1:00 pm on Thursday, August 14, <br />1997. The Inspection will be conducted by the Division of Minerals and Geology (Division), and will <br />begin at the Northern #I Mine identification sign on State Highway 13 between Meeker and Craig <br />(approximately one mile south of the summit of Ninemile Gap pass). The Inspection applies to a request <br />for release of remaining coal mine reclamation bond monies. <br />The State of Colorado holds bonds for reclamation of disturbed areas at coal mines in Colorado. The <br />Meeker Area mines are permitted by [he Division under Permit Number C-81-032 to the Enron Coal <br />Company (Enron). The original reclamation bond was for $80,000. Rules of the Colorado Surface Coal <br />Mining Reclamation Act (Rules) permit progressive release of reclamation bonds. .stage of the <br />bond may be released (a Phase 1 release) for backfilling and grading, and an additio-. ' ntage (a Phase <br />[I release) for establishment of vegetation, which supports the approved postmining land use. Disturbed <br />surface areas of the mines were backfilled, regraded and reseeded in 1986 and 1992. Phase 1 and Phase II <br />releases reduced the reclamation bond to $184,071. By letter of May 7, 1997, Enron submitted a request <br />for a final Phase it/Ifl bond release at the Meeker Area Mines. The request was considered complete for <br />filing after receipt of proof of publication of the request in The ~Yfeeker Herald. <br />The Inspection will be conducted to determine, in part, if release of the remaining $184,071 is <br />appropriate. Inherent with granting of the request is the termination of Permit C-81-032 and any <br />jurisdiction by the Division.
